
PAGADIAN CITY (Mindanao Examiner / Nov. 15, 2013) – Unidentified gunmen ambushed a village official in the town of Mahayag in Zamboanga del Sur province in southern Philippines, police said Friday.
Police said Julius Lapinig, a council member in th village of Manguiles, was driving his motorcycle with his wife as passenger, when three gunmen shot him at Purok Sinco. His wife managed to escape and reported the attack to the police.
The assailants fled after the shooting leaving behind the 41-year old official bathed in his own pool of blood. Police said investigators recovered 5 bullet casings of .45-caliber and 9mm pistols in the area.
No group claimed responsibility for the killing and it was unknown whether the attack was connected to politics or not. Police are investigating the murder. (Mindanao Examiner)
